Well its been a strange and frustrating 18′s competition so far, last night we went down 4:3 to the favoured USA team, and it has to be said the 1st USA goal should never have been counted – the ref blew the whistle after the netminder made a save, a couple of seconds later the puck bobbled over the line and he gave a goal !! how does that work ?!!!?!? anyways, lose we did 4:3. In the other games New Zealand looked strong as they beat Germany, and Columbia beat Hong Kong.
And so to tonight . . . we played New Zealand and it was clear from the first shift that this was going to be a tough physical game as Cal was hip checked and limped off, fortunately to return a couple of shifts later, but that’s the way the game was being played.
It was end to end for the whole game, and after GB took a 2:0 lead early on, the Kiwis kept coming back and finally levelled it 2:2 before taking the lead, with GB levelling to 3:3 going into the last few minutes, sadly those Kiwis pulled another goal and GB couldn’t find a way through – final score 4:3 in a heart stopping tough game of hockey ( photos here )
